Protesters disrupt church service over ICE pastor in Minnesota | DW News
Protesters disrupted a church service in St. Paul, Minnesota, where activists allege a local ICE official works as a pastor. Protests in the US state continue after the fatal shooting of 37-year-old Renee Good by an ICE agent. The Justice Department is now investigating whether the disruption violated federal protections for worship.
